A Christmas Carol and The Chimes is a collection of two classic novellas by Charles Dickens, originally published in 1886. The first novella, A Christmas Carol, tells the story of Ebenezer Scrooge, a miserly old man who is visited by the ghosts of Christmas Past, Present, and Yet to Come. Through these supernatural encounters, Scrooge learns the true meaning of Christmas and is transformed into a kinder, more generous person. The second novella, The Chimes, follows the story of Toby Veck, a poor messenger who is disillusioned with life and contemplates suicide on New Year's Eve. However, he is visited by spirits who show him the consequences of his actions and inspire him to have hope for the future.
